Understanding Semaglutide: An Innovative Solution in Weight Management and Diabetes Care
Semaglutide is a glucagon-like peptide-1 (GLP-1) receptor agonist, originally developed to treat type 2 diabetes. However, during clinical trials, it demonstrated remarkable efficacy in promoting weight loss, leading to its approval as a weight management medication under various brands, including Wegovy and Ozempic.
This medication works primarily by mimicking the GLP-1 hormone, which regulates blood sugar levels, suppresses appetite, and slows gastric emptying. These effects contribute to better blood sugar control and reduced calorie intake, making semaglutide a dual-action drug beneficial for both diabetics and individuals seeking weight reduction.

3. Pharmacological Combinations: What Do You Mix Semaglutide With?
While monotherapy with semaglutide is effective, some cases involve combination pharmacotherapy under medical supervision. These include:
- Metformin: Often prescribed alongside semaglutide for comprehensive glycemic control in type 2 diabetes.
- Other GLP-1 Receptor Agonists: Sometimes combined with drugs like dulaglutide or liraglutide in complex cases, though this requires careful evaluation.
- SGLT2 Inhibitors: To enhance glucose regulation, used under strict medical supervision.
Such combinations must be managed by physicians due to potential interactions and side effects.

Q2: Can I combine semaglutide with insulin?
Answer: This combination must be prescribed and supervised by your healthcare provider, particularly if you have diabetes, to avoid hypoglycemia.
